Christmas ParadeThe Plymouth Chamber of Commerce and Discover Plymouth are currently seeking entries for the 2016 Christmas Parade of Light on Saturday, November 26th.   This year’s theme is “Home for the Holidays.”

The parade through downtown Plymouth steps off at 6 p.m. and will travel south on Michigan Street as a prelude to city’s Christmas Tree Lighting.

Applications are now available on the Plymouth Chambers of Commerce website for floats and units to participate in the parade.  There is NO COST!  The committee is looking for floats, vehicles and walking units to participate.  There is a requirement that floats, vehicles and walkers be lighted with generators or other power sources.

Because the parade is in the evening they request no throwing of candy or items from the floats or being passed out by walkers.

At the conclusion of the lighted Christmas parade, Santa will arrive on a Plymouth Fire Truck and make his way to the Marshall County Museum where he will greet kids for a quick chat and photo opt.  Fireworks are expected to light up the sky and the Christmas Light Show at River Park Square will be unveiled.
